My Thoughts on 2008, 2009 and Resolutions

Some of my friends and family think I’m weird. I don’t believe in luck or superstition. At all. I’m one of those crazy people who thinks we make our own destiny with the choices we make every day. So when, once a year, everyone goes around making “resolutions” for the new year I just kind of chuckle a little and once again look strange. I don’t make resolutions either.

New Year’s Resolutions are made in good faith, really. Most people think they’re doing something positive by making a goal to get something done (or stop doing something, or start) in a new year. The problem is simply that life moves at you so fast, things change and you may be in a completely different place in another 365 days.

Ever year I do revisit my goals… I revisit the same short and long-term goals that I had in the previous year and re-evaluate whether they’re still appropriate moving forward. Maybe I don’t really want to keep learning the guitar, or maybe I want to start kickboxing instead of running a marathon. So what? You shouldn’t feel bad about breaking a “resolution” you made with yourself just because you changed your mind, or because life threw a curveball at you.
